World’s first sanctuary for rescued dolphins opens on Greek island of Lipsi
- The world’s first permanent sanctuary for dolphins rescued from captivity has been founded by the Archipelagos Institute of Marine Conservation.
- The sanctuary is located on the north side of the Lipsi island (Greece) and its aim is to offer refuge to stranded, injured and formerly captive dolphins.
